Tho ordinary meeting of the Wellington City Council on Thursday next will be. preceded by a special meeting, convened for the purpose of passing a special order making the following . by-law-.—(I) No person shall depasture any horses, cattle, sheep, goals, or other live, stock on any land of the corporation forming part, of the catchment area of the corporation's reservoirs at Karori and Wainni-o-ninta j (2) if any horse, cattle, sheep, goat, or other live stock shall bo found on any such lands, the owner of such stock shall bo guilty of an offenco against this bylaw.
